As part of the Services, Kashew may arrange for international shipments from Sellers to Buyers. If you are a non-U.S. Buyer, you may grant Kashew the power of attorney to facilitate international shipments to you and represent and warrant that you are purchasing the Goods for personal, casual consumption or use and not for resale (unless otherwise permitted).
Each non-U.S. Buyer may grant to Kashew (and any third party service providers) authorization to act as your agent(s) (with permission to further delegate their authority) and to retain customs brokers and/or freight forwarders for the purpose of transacting customs business with all relevant customs and revenue authorities on your behalf. This authorization may include making declarations and/or completing filings on your behalf in connection with the import of the Goods into the country of import, arranging for the exportation and/or importation of the Goods, assigning Harmonized System classification codes (“HS Codes”) or other commodity codes, paying and accounting for duties and taxes on your behalf, and managing any dispute with such authorities. Kashew accepts no responsibility for the accuracy of any HS Codes assigned to the Goods as part of the import or export process and Kashew shall not be liable for any damages or penalties arising out of or related to the assignment of HS Codes.
Unless stated otherwise, title to the Goods remains with Sellers until such time as the Goods are successfully delivered to the Buyer, at which time title to the Goods shall transfer to the Buyer. Unless required otherwise, Kashew or its third party providers at no time act as importers of record. You acknowledge and agree that Kashew is providing a facilitation role for convenience only and that you, as the Buyer, are ultimately responsible for the payment of duties and taxes, for accounting documentation and record-keeping in relation to the requirements of the country of import, and that you must determine whether the Goods you intend to import are subject to any prohibitions, permits, restrictions or regulations.
